About Toru Igari

Toru Igari is a scholar working on Microbiology, Hepatology and Surgery, having authored 69 papers that have together received 729 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Viral-associated cancers and disorders (6 papers), Gastrointestinal disorders and treatments (5 papers) and Esophageal Cancer Research and Treatment (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Oncology (200 citations), Surgery (277 citations) and Reproductive Medicine (48 citations). Toru Igari has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include Naoyoshi Nagata, Junichi Akiyama, Naomi Uemura, Sankichi Horiuchi, Naoki Yamamoto, Narihide Goseki, Hideaki Yano, Shinichi Oka, Nobuo Kondoh and Akihide Ryo.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Blood and PLoS ONE.
